It honestly depends on so many factors. For intake you have to consider the installation and maintenance issues. Stillen G3 intake is a long tube intake that requires cutting a plastic piece bracket behind you front bumper, also you will need to remove the bumper if you need to clean your filters or uninstall intake. The Injen is also long tube, requires no modification but does require you to remove bumper to clean filters or uninstall intake. Then there are short ram intakes, R2C and K&N are the only worthy ones since they have heatshields and require no bumper removal.

I can't even begin with the exhaust option though, you are right that there are many options. So it really all depends on your preference of price, sound, how the exhaust looks.
